"Bridge Engineering" by S. Ponnuswamy is a comprehensive and highly regarded resource for both students and practicing civil engineers.
Below is a detailed review of the textbook, covering its core content, strengths, and target audience. 📘 Book Overview
The book provides a solid foundation in the principles of bridge engineering. It covers everything from initial planning and investigation to detailed design, construction methods, and maintenance. 🔑 Key Topics Covered Short story: "Bridge Engineering — S
Investigation and Planning: Site selection, hydraulic studies, and economic spans.
Loading Standards: Detailed explanations of IRC (Indian Roads Congress) and other loading codes.
Superstructure Design: RC bridges, prestressed concrete, and steel bridges. Substructure Design: Piers, abutments, and wing walls.
Foundations: Shallow, pile, and well foundations (caissons). Bearings & Joints: Types, selection, and design principles.
Advanced Topics: Bridge construction techniques, maintenance, and rehabilitation. ⭐ Strengths
Comprehensive Scope: It covers the entire lifecycle of a bridge project.
Practical Focus: The book bridges the gap between theoretical mechanics and real-world field applications.
Code Compliance: Excellent alignment with Indian standard codes (IRC), making it perfect for the Indian subcontinent.
Visual Aids: Rich with diagrams, sketches, and photographs to explain complex structural details. ⚠️ Limitations
Regional Focus: Primarily tailored to Indian standards (IRC), which may limit its use in countries following AASHTO or Eurocodes.
Advanced Analysis: Engineers looking for deep dives into complex finite element modeling (FEM) of cable-stayed or suspension bridges might need supplementary advanced texts. 🎯 Target Audience

The book is unique in that it does not treat bridge design in isolation. Instead, it integrates basic design approaches with real-world case studies to provide a holistic view of the field. Key Areas Covered:
Site Investigation: In-depth guidance on selecting bridge sites and conducting necessary hydraulic and geotechnical investigations. Free textbooks and lecture materials (e
Design Standards: The latest editions reflect modern technology and revised standards, including specific references to IRC (Indian Roads Congress) and IRS (Indian Railway Standard) loadings.
Superstructures and Foundations: Detailed design methodologies for various components, including RC (reinforced concrete) culverts, tee beams, and steel superstructures.
Maintenance and Rehabilitation: Comprehensive sections on inspection, monitoring, and the rebuilding of aging structures. 2. Evolution Across Editions
The third edition of Bridge Engineering has been significantly expanded to address contemporary engineering challenges and technological advancements.
New Chapters: Inclusion of specialized topics such as Cable-Supported Bridges, Steel and Concrete Arches, and Grade Separators.
Global Context: While focused on Indian requirements, it includes details on British and American loadings for comparative designer appreciation.
Historical Perspective: An annexure dedicated to the history of bridge building in India provides valuable context for the evolution of local construction techniques. 3. Why It is a "Must-Have" for Engineers
